Taylor Swift rumoured to play villain in ‘Cruella 2’

Taylor Swift is reportedly joining the cast of Cruella 2. While the 2021 release of Disney’s live-action is renewed for a sequel, it is expected that the Blank Space hitmaker is coming on board for an important role. According to The Hollywood Reporter, Disney is moving forward with Cruella 2 after the first movie’s satisfying performance at the box office and Disney+ Premier Access, as well as its positive reception from critics and audiences alike. However, rumour has it that Taylor Swift may also have a major role in the movie. Recently, Paul Walter Hauser (Horace) revealed the sequel will likely begin filming next year. According to The Disney Insider, there’s a rumour that “Cruella 2” will be a musical and that Taylor Swift is being eyed as the movie’s villain. Looking for Easter eggs in the first movie, some fans do believe that there was a glimpse of Taylor Swift. The character didn’t have a name or proper role, but fans assumed it was Taylor Swift according to the picture on the wall. Disney is yet to confirm the rumours around Cruella.
